Champions League Draw: Key Details on the New Format
The revamped Champions League draw is set to occur today at 5 p.m. (UK time) on Thursday. For the 2024/25 season, the tournament has undergone significant changes, expanding from 32 to 36 clubs.
The most notable shift is the transition from the traditional group stage to a single league phase, where all participating teams will compete against each other.
This overhaul increases the number of fixtures from 125 to 189, and the league phase will conclude at the end of January, extending beyond the usual December finish.
Teams will play 17 matches throughout the competition. Each club will face eight different opponents—four home and four away—ensuring a minimum of eight league-stage games, compared to the previous format of six matches against three teams.
The top eight teams will advance directly to the knockout stages, while those finishing in 9th to 24th place will enter a two-legged play-off for a spot in the last 16. Teams ranked 25th to 36th will be eliminated from the tournament.
